We are looking for a Restaurant Waiter to join our Dear Jackie team @Broadwick Soho. The on target earning potential for this role is £38,000 per annum (£18.21 per hour) based on working 40 hours over 5 days a week - comprising a base salary of £13.58 per hour plus a qualified estimate of £9,676 per annum in gratuities and service charge.
What is in it for you?
- Inclusion in the Tronc scheme which includes Rooms and F&B service charge.
- 30 days holiday inclusive of bank holidays increasing with the length of service.
- Bravo Broadwick our bespoke reward and recognition scheme to recognise birthdays, anniversaries and inspirational service.
- Pension scheme, season ticket travel loan, cycle-to-work scheme, Medicash health plan.
- Great food and drink during your shift.
- Designer outfits that represent our spirit and personality that are fresh and ready for your shift.
- Support from our Employee Assistance Programme, wellbeing initiatives and company discretionary sick pay scheme after 6 months length of service.
- Great incentives including refer a friend bonus (£1000 for chefs & £500 for all other roles) and friends & family discounts, and a Guest Experience after successful completion of probationary period.

How to prepare for a job interview at Broadwick Soho
✨Know the Menu Inside Out
Familiarise yourself with the menu and any specials before the interview. Being able to discuss dishes confidently will show your enthusiasm for the role and your commitment to providing excellent service.
✨Showcase Your People Skills
Prepare examples of how you've built rapport with guests in previous roles. Highlighting your ability to connect with people will demonstrate that you understand the importance of creating memorable experiences.
✨Demonstrate Your Team Spirit
Be ready to talk about times when you've worked effectively in a team. This role requires collaboration, so sharing your experiences of supporting colleagues and working towards a common goal will resonate well.
✨Emphasise Your Adaptability
Since the job may involve multi-skilling, think of instances where you've successfully juggled multiple tasks or adapted to changing situations. This will show that you're ready to meet the dynamic needs of the restaurant.
